WebMar 29, 2024 · This ossicular chain conducts sound from the tympanic membrane to the inner ear, which has been known since the time of Galen (2nd century ce) as the labyrinth. It is a complicated system of fluid-filled passages and cavities located deep within the rock-hard petrous portion of the temporal bone. WebPerilymph has an ionic composition similar to extracellular fluid found elsewhere in the body (i.e., it is K + -poor and Na + -rich), and it fills the scalae tympani and vestibule. Hearing depends on the high K + concentration in endolymph that bathes the apical membranes of sensory hair cells.

WebFeb 9, 2024 · Endolymph, also known as Scarpa fluid, is a clear fluid found in the inner ear's membranous labyrinth. It is unique in composition compared to other extracellular fluids in the body due to its high potassium ion concentration (140 mEq/L) and low sodium ion concentration (15 mEq/L).[1] WebWhere is perilymph located within the cochlea? Perilymph fills the cavities of the bony labyrinth of the cochlea, the scala vestibuli, and the scala tympani. WebA perilymph fistula (PLF) is a tear in either one of the membranes separating your middle and inner ear. Your middle ear is filled with air. Your inner ear, on the other hand, is filled with fluid called perilymph. Usually, thin membranes at openings called oval and round windows separate your inner and middle ear. WebThe pressure changes in the cochlea caused by sound entering the ear travel down the fluid filled tympanic and vestibular canals which are filled with a fluid called perilymph. This perilymph is almost identical to spinal fluid and differs significantly from the endolymph which fills the cochlear duct and surrounds the sensitive organ of Corti.
